Frequently Asked Questions about River North
What type of rentals are currently available in River North?
There are currently 221 Apartments for Rent in River North, IL with pricing that ranges from $1,207 to $48,409. There are also 304 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in River North ranging from $2,000 to $20,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in River North?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in River North ranges from $2,000 to $20,000 with an average monthly rent of $8,651.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in River North?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in River North range from $5,100 to $38,481,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$5,200 to $6,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$9,750 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,207.
